概述:
随着智慧城市的快速发展和对环境监测、智能安防等需求的日益增长,本方案旨在提供一套涵盖水质检测、油烟监控等多个领域的综合性物联网系统。该系统的硬件核心采用STM32系列单片机,并辅以ESP8266/ESP32无线通信模组进行数据传输。
功能模块介绍:
- 水质检测物联网: 利用STM32单片机采集水体的PH值、溶解氧等参数,通过ESP8266模组将数据发送至云端服务器进行实时监控。
- 油烟监测系统:采用ESP32开发板与烟雾传感器结合实现对厨房内的有害气体浓度检测,并具备超标报警功能。该方案广泛应用于西安餐饮业的智能管理中。
技术选型考量:
- 选择STM32作为主控芯片,因其强大的运算能力和丰富的外设资源,在单片机开发领域具有很高的性价比和应用灵活性;同时支持各种无线通信模块如ESP8266、Cat1模组等。
- 合宙LuatOS系统的引入,使得物联网设备能够更加方便地实现远程管理与升级维护功能。该操作系统特别适合于西安地区的智慧城市项目开发中使用。
技术难点分析:
- 如何保证数据传输的安全性和稳定性是整个系统设计时需要重点考虑的问题,特别是在户外环境下部署的设备可能会遇到复杂的电磁环境干扰问题。为解决此难题,在硬件选型上会选择抗噪性能优良的产品,并且在软件层面采用加密协议保护通信安全。
- 智能安防物联网部分,需要关注如何通过算法优化来提高人脸识别和行为分析的准确率。这要求团队成员具备深厚的人工智能背景知识和技术积累,并且能够利用西安本地高校资源进行合作研究。
开发周期预估:
- 前期调研与需求确认:1个月左右;
中期产品研发阶段(包括硬件设计、软件编码及调试):单片机编程专家团队预计需要4-6月时间完成。 - 后期测试优化:3个月,确保产品功能完整且稳定可靠;
市场推广与客户反馈收集:12个月内分阶段执行。整个项目周期大约为一年半左右。
人员配置建议: 根据上述开发计划,我们推荐组建一个由8至15名成员组成的团队来负责此项目的各个阶段工作。其中包括项目经理、硬件工程师、软件开发者和测试员等角色。
